Weird Tachometer Issue
This morning I went for a ride and I noticed my tach wasn't working at all. The threaded ferrule on the tach side sometimes comes loose and the cable drops out. When I got where I was going, I checked it and it was tight. I removed the cable from the tach and noticed it wasn't spinning. I grabbed the end and pushed it down into the cable and it started spinning. Weird but ok. I threaded it back in and once again, nothing.
What's going on here? Why is the rod part of the cable not staying put when it's in the tach?Tags: None

I happens. This is the pic of the engine end of my tach cable a few weeks ago. Worked when I parked the bike up for the winter. Broken on first run this spring. Yes, if you can pull the innards up through the top, it's broken. You'll see when you undo the bottom end.
